What does Arash mean and where does it come from?
The name Arash is of Persian origin and is well-known in Iranian mythology, where Arash was a legendary archer who shot an arrow to determine Iran's borders. The story of Arash
Arash is a relatively modern name, first appearing in US records in 1972. With 889 total births recorded, Arash remains relatively uncommon. Once ranked #3066 in 1975, the name has become less common in recent years, sitting at #5477 in 2023.
